LOGIN“Nephew…can you explain why my wife knows you?” The question came from Damien, my new husband. Brian stared at the ring on my finger, then slowly, his eyes lifted to the man standing next to me. The man whose arms were tightened around my waist. Everyone in the room was staring at me, and the man standing across from me had just turned white. My ex-husband, The husband who abandoned me three years ago. The husband who was apparently… Damien’s nephew. ~~~ I thought I had buried that part of my life. The grief. The betrayal. The little pink coffin that took my daughter away forever and Brian, the man who left me alone in the hospital while our child was dying. Three years later, I finally learned how to breathe again. In other to repay the kindness of the Stark family, I decided to marry a stranger. Damien is cold, controlled and impossible to read. A billionaire heir trapped in a one year marriage contract by his families. I married him and for the first time in years, I felt free… Until one family dinner changed everything. Now my dead marriage isn’t so dead. My ex-husband wants a second chance. My new husband wants answers. And Damien has just discovered that the woman he calls wife once belonged to his own blood. The problem? Damien doesn’t share. And he certainly doesn’t let go…Not of what’s his.
